A consumer products company surveys 30 shoppers at a mall and asks each one if he/she likes the packaging of a new soap product. The results of the survey are:
Yes: 10; No: 19; No opinion: 1.
(a) Use these data to estimate the proportion of shoppers who would like the package for the soap.
(b) Suppose the company gathered these data by talking to customers in one of their stores. What impact might this have on the results. Suggest a better way to gather the data.
